The Cheynes Beach Whaling Company was the last whaling company to stop operations in Australia, closing in 1978. Opening in 1980 (known then as Whale World), it’s now residence to an interactive museum on whales and whaling. The King George Sound was the site of Western Australia’s first European settlement, settled a quantity of years before the Swan River Colony in Perth. Albany’s protected anchorages attracted many crusing ships in the early years of exploration of the Australian coastline. European settlement began in 1826 and Albany grew right into a thriving port through the 19th and twentieth centuries.

The old whaling station at Discovery Bay is now a fascinating museum and is nicely price a go to to find the region’s current historical past. Climb aboard the Cheynes IV whaling vessel or go to the Giants of the Sea exhibit. It just isn’t unusual to see the protected whales breaching and playing near the station, where they as soon as have been hunted.

More current historical past is clear on the excellent National Anzac Centre, looking out over King George Sound. It was from here during World War I, that the primary convoy of ANZACs set forth to Europe. The centre homes interactive shows, historic artefacts, and tells the private stories of ANZACs.

The pink tingle tree is a type of eucalyptus tree, can develop above 60m high and may reside over four hundred years old. Their roots are particularly fragile and subject to erosion, hence the explanation for the suspended walkway. As many locations in Australia, Albany was constructed on convict labour… The Albany Old Gaol was inbuilt 1852 to accommodate convicts transported to work as labourers. After an extension in 1873, it was commissioned as an official gaol and used as a police lock-up in the course of the Depression. At the entry, you’re handed the cardboard of someone who sailed from Albany more than a hundred years in the past, personalising the expertise. Their story is unveiled through interactive media as you progress by way of the museum, which also options 1000’s of artefacts, movie and pictures. By the time you attain the tribute wall to go away a private message, you’ll be overwhelmed with awe and gratitude for his or her sacrifices. Estimated to be over 7,500 years old, they were constructed by the Menang peoples to entice fish after excessive tide. Take a tour with Kurrah Mia to study in regards to the fish traps and different historic tales of the land. The Menang Noongar folks had been the primary inhabitants of the realm generally recognized as Kinjarling or ‘place of plenty,’ typically interpreted as ‘place of rain’ because of the excessive rainfall within the area. Stirling Range National Park is home to the only major mountain vary in the southern space of WA, rising to more than 1000m above sea level and making a challenging and spectacular climbing expertise. The Aboriginal name for the range, Koi Kyenunu-ruff, meaning ‘mist rolling around the mountains’ is a frequently seen incidence.

The lookouts at the Gap and Natural Bridge provide some of the most iconic ocean views within the State. The accessible viewing platform on the Gap is forty metres above sea-level; anchored to secure rock, whereas the Natural Bridge provides a much less confronting, however nonetheless picturesque window to the exposed coastline. Both lookouts are within the Torndirrup National Park and provide stellar views of the Southern Ocean, Bald Head and West Cape Howe. The Blowholes, as the name suggests, “blow” water up by way of a crack in the granite, producing a wondrous (and at times very loud) spray. There can be a preferred walking path to the Blowholes, a 1.6km return journey from the carpark.
